AM expanded band allotment
Article Abstract:
The FCC plans to expand the AM band spectrum to 1705 kHz and will notify stations eligible to migrate to new channels. The stations' application deadline is mid-June, 1997. Stations not awarded allotments can petition the FCC for reconsideration. Stations may be interested in migrating as a way of reducing AM signal interference. A table is included detailing the stations eligible to move under the allotment plan.
